I got HTTP error when i upload a photo with 1.6 MB in my host. Here is the upload screen.

But I got error like http://prntscr.com/89q2p when it have been to 100%. But it is ok when i upload demo.chevereto.com. I don't know want is wrong in my host.

Somebody know about it?

Create an empty file named info.php on the root of your chevereto directory.

Put the following in :

PHP:
<?php
phpinfo();

and search withing the file to string similar to : max_upload_size (I don't remember what is exactly the correct name)
You will see there what is the limit of your upload size, and if it is smaller than 1.6 MB, you will have your answer to your problem.
